Transaction 73b93389d9a20f31e72f33e38d4ab080269500897a824f98df7df35ea2c19d0b
2 Input
2 Outputs
- 73b93389d9a20f31e72f33e38d4ab080269500897a824f98df7df35ea2c19d0b:0
- 73b93389d9a20f31e72f33e38d4ab080269500897a824f98df7df35ea2c19d0b:1
value 852773
address 19pY8CAryd52jdvd64xCfvtYFNdjUoots1
value 3419552
address 1HUWbtdz34EgyHtA625fySrFyLtpuMTCK5